)300i flashing stops with prodigy -> dead phone?


Hello

I tried to flash nokia 9300i with prodigy LPT device, ca-53-cable and NSS software. The MCU flashin was ok but after that I get repeating message "Waiting ADL prosess completion..." it didn't continued after that.

Now the phone is dead and I cant connect to it to start new flashing prosess.

The flash files where:
MCU: RA8_5500.1501
PPM: -
CP: -
ADSP: RA8n5500.c01
APE V: RA8n5500.l02
APE U: RA8n5500.l02

Now afterwards I think that "APE U" file was wrong. Shoul it be "RA8n5500.c02"?

Is there anything to do to get the phone back to life?

APE User file is "u" marked.
The correct files are:
MCU: RA8_5500.1501
PPM: -
CP: -
ADSP: RA8n5500.c01
APE V: RA8n5500.l02
APE U: RA8n5500.u02

Second problem was you have to connect both cables for flashing 9300i. Connect the FBUS-cable between box and phone and connect the CA-53 cable too.

Thanx for the right file info. Now the phone is back in life.

I tried different NSS versions and different loader versions, almoust every time the prosess ends with "Can't erase". The NSS28b and flash loader v3.21.. was the only working combimation.

Btw. Is there some place where we can get flash loaders? I tried to install different phoenix version, just one of them had the Flash directory but everyone had the FlashUSB directory. I also copied some loaders from other third party flashers.
